Cheryl Ferrer joined Prosthodontic Associates in 2010. She attended the George Brown College/Ryerson University Accounting program but traded in her pencil and paper for some alginate and an impression tray.
“A smile is the most beautiful attire anyone can wear, and it never goes out of style. It’s my passion to help our patients get their smiles back”, is her motto.
She enrolled in the dental program at CDI College in 2006 obtaining her Dental Assistant Level I and Dental Administration and eventually graduated as a Level II Dental Assistant, obtaining her NDAEB (2009) designation. In 2017 she obtained certification as a Treatment Coordinator in order to offer a more comprehensive experience for her patients.
Other than being the resident chef at PA, Cheryl enjoys reading magazines and keeping up with global issues. She likes to rewind at the spa and is also a trained aesthetician. You can see her work around PA as she likes to work on eyelashes and her coworkers are her best clients.
